Frequently Asked Questions
Do you provide insurance?
No. We do not provide traditional auto insurance. All renters must either upload valid personal auto insurance that extends to rental vehicles or select one of our Damage Waiver options at booking:
Standard Protection – $35/day: You’re protected against major repair bills. Your responsibility is capped at $2,000 per incident, and we take care of the rest.
Premium Protection – $50/day: You get complete peace of mind. You’ll have no out-of-pocket costs for damage - everything is fully covered.
The Damage Waiver is automatically added at the time of booking if no valid insurance is uploaded. If insurance is uploaded and approved during the booking process, the waiver can be removed. No exceptions.

Do I need to buy the Damage Waiver if I have my own insurance?
Maybe. If your personal auto policy includes liability and collision coverage, you can upload a copy of your insurance declarations page and the Damage Waiver requirement will be removed.
If your policy is liability-only, or if you cannot provide proof of collision coverage, you must select one of our waivers:
Standard Protection – $35/day: You’re protected against major repair bills. Your responsibility is capped at $2,000 per incident, and we take care of the rest.
Premium Protection – $50/day: You get complete peace of mind. You’ll have no out-of-pocket costs for damage - everything is fully covered.
A standard insurance ID card is not enough — it only shows liability coverage. We must see your declarations page or a screenshot from your insurance company’s app that clearly lists collision coverage.
Am I covered by my own insurance?
Most personal auto policies include rental cars, but not all. It’s your responsibility to confirm with your insurance company. Either way, you’re responsible for any damage to the rental. If your policy doesn’t cover it, you’ll need to pay out of pocket or choose our optional Damage Waiver.

Are your vehicles RMV-approved for road tests?
Yes. All of our road test rental vehicles meet Massachusetts RMV requirements. They’re fully insured, have current registration and inspection, and include an emergency brake in the center console. We also provide a completed sponsor form for the licensed driver accompanying the permit holder. Everything you need to pass your test with confidence. Important: Be sure to select the “Road Test Appointment” add-on when booking so we can prepare the car and paperwork ahead of time.
Are your vehicles tracked with GPS?
Yes. All our vehicles have GPS trackers with tamper alerts for mileage verification, theft prevention, and recovery. By renting, you agree not to remove, disable, or interfere with the device. Tampering or losing the GPS will result in a $350 charge and may end your rental immediately.
How do tolls work with my rental?
All vehicles come with a built-in Massachusetts E-ZPass transponder. If you pass through any tolls, we’ll charge the toll amount to your card after the rental, plus a $3 processing fee per toll to cover admin costs.
Example:
If you hit 3 tolls totaling $7.50, your card will be charged $16.50 ($7.50 in tolls + $9 in admin fees).
We’ll send you an email with a breakdown if any tolls are charged after your trip.

Do you rent to under 25?
Yes. The minimum rental age is 21. Drivers ages 21–24 are welcome, but a $25/day underage fee applies.
Can I return after-hours?
Yes. All rentals use lockboxes. You’ll pick up your car using a code, and return it the same way - just put the key back in the lockbox, attach it to the window, and park in one of the designated reserved spots.
Can I pay with debit?
Yes, we accept all major debit cards. A $300 refundable security deposit will be placed as a pre-authorization hold at the time of pickup. The hold is released automatically after the vehicle is returned without issues. Debit cards must be in the renter’s name, and the full amount must be available on the card at the time of pickup.
